Fedorov Grigory Fedorovich

Definition:

Party and economic figure

Years of life: 1891-1936

Born in 1891 in St. Petersburg; Russian; basic education; 6th-category fitter-patternmaker; member of the All-Union Communist Party (Bolsheviks) in 1907-1934. Active participant in the February Revolution, deputy of the Petrograd Soviet of Workers' and Soldiers' Deputies, and from April 1917 - member of the Central Committee of the RSDLP (Bolsheviks). During the Civil War, he worked in party and Soviet work in Nizhny Novgorod and Saratov, and was head of the political department of the 13th and 14th armies of the Southern Front. In March 1921, along with other delegates to the 10th Congress of the RCP (Bolsheviks), he took part in the suppression of the Kronstadt rebellion. From 1921 onwards, he worked in trade unions and government work. Member of the All-Union Central Executive Committee. In 1927, he was expelled from the party by the 15th Congress of the All-Union Communist Party (Bolsheviks).   As an active member of the Trotskyist opposition, he was reinstated in 1928. He served as deputy chairman of the Metal Syndicate, then headed the All-Union Cartographic Trust. In 1934, he was expelled again. Arrested on December 16, 1934. Sentenced on January 15-16, 1935, by the Military Collegium of the Supreme Court of the USSR to 10 years in a labor camp as one of the leaders of the Moscow Center. Arrested on September 4, 1936. Sentenced on October 5, 1936.   The Supreme Commander-in-Chief of the Supreme Soviet of the USSR was sentenced to capital punishment on charges of counterrevolutionary terrorist activity. He was executed on October 5, 1936. Burial place: Moscow, Donskoye Cemetery. He was rehabilitated by the Supreme Commander-in-Chief of the Supreme Soviet of the USSR on March 28, 1959, based on the 1936 sentence, and on July 7, 1965, based on the 1935 sentence.
